A complete guide for first-time visitors to Phuket. Save it for later!

Phuket, located in the Andaman Sea in southern Thailand, is the largest island in Thailand and the smallest province. Phuket is known as the pearl of the Andaman Sea for its charming scenery and rich tourism resources. Phuket is located in the tropics and has a humid tropical climate. It is summer all year round. From April to September each year, when the sun is directly above the equator, it is the rainy season in Phuket, especially in May, when it rains almost every day. 1. Accommodation: Phuket's tourism industry is mature, with complete accommodation facilities and a wide range of types. From beaches to towns, from five-star hotels to backpacker budget hotels, it can meet the choices of different tourists. Among them, Patong Beach has the most accommodation options. The nightlife here is rich and colorful, and there are many shopping and dining options, so it is very popular. This is also the cheapest beach in Phuket, and it costs about 2,000 baht to stay in a beach hotel here for one night. 4-5 star hotels cost about 4,000~6,000 baht. During the off-peak tourist season, you can enjoy a 40%-50% discount. There are fewer budget hotels here, most of them are a bit far from the coast, and the room rate is about 300 baht/room. 2. Transportation: On the island, you can choose public transportation such as taxis, double cars (ie minibuses) and motorcycles. In addition, renting a motorcycle or car is also a more free choice. Please pay attention to local traffic rules and precautions. 3. Itinerary planning: - Day 1: Arrival and beach exploration. After arriving in Phuket, you can first go to your chosen accommodation to check in and take a break. Then, you can go to the nearest beach, such as Patong Beach or Bob Beach, to enjoy the sun and beach. In the evening, you can stroll along the beach and enjoy the beautiful sunset. - Day 2: Explore Phuket Town and cultural heritage. On the second day, you can visit the main city of Phuket, Phuket Town. There are many temples of historical value here, such as Phuket Temple and Fairy Temple. You can also visit the market in Phuket Town to experience the local atmosphere. - Day 3: One-day tour of the outlying islands. Phuket has many beautiful outlying islands, such as Phi Phi Island, Similan Island, etc. You can participate in a one-day tour to go snorkeling, diving or enjoy the beach on these outlying islands. - Day 4: One-day tour around the island. In the inland of Phuket, you can pack a car, find the most local food, and visit the most charming scenery. You can visit Phuket's waterfalls, mountain tribes and agricultural areas to experience local culture and lifestyle. 4. Precautions: When traveling in Phuket, please pay attention to sun protection, bring sunscreen and sun hat. At the same time, please respect local culture and customs and abide by local laws and regulations. When tasting local food, please pay attention to food safety and avoid food poisoning.
